Optimization of Self-microemulsion Drug Delivery System of Ursolic Acid by Central Composite Design/Response Surface Methodology
Objective: To optimize formulation of ursolic acid self-microemulsion drug delivery system using central composite design/response surface methodology. Method: With ratio of surfactants and cosurfactants and oil content as independent variables
particle size and saturated drug doading were taken as dependent variables
optimum formulation was screened by SAS9.1.3 software
and verified. Result: Optimized formulation of ursolic acid self-microemulsion was oil phase(MCT)-emulsifier(HS15)-cosurfactants(alcohol) 12.5:62.5:25. Conclusion: This optimized formulation of ursolic acid self-microemulsion drug delivery system could be obtained exactly and conveniently by central composite design response surface methodology
and established model had a reliable predictability.
